Zotac AMP GeForce GTX 480 1536 MB Graphics Card 384-bit (756MHz/3800MHz) ZT-40102-10P Product Description:



  • NVIDIA GeForce GTX 480 GPU, 480 Unified Shaders, 1536MB GDDR5, 384-bit memory bus, Core Clock: 756 MHz
  • DirectX 11 support, OpenGL 3.2, NVIDIA ForceWare Drivers, Windows XP/Vista/7
  • NVIDIA Unified Architecture, NVIDIA 3D Vision Surround ready, NVIDIA PhysX Technology, NVIDIA CUDA Technology
  • Dual dual-link DVI (Up to 2560x1600), Mini-HDMI 1.3a w/audio (8-channel LPCM), HDCP ready
  • ED 480p, HD 720p, HD 1080i, Full HD 1080p

4Excellent Card w/ Issues. // Reviewed Post
By Luis G. Rodriguez
I wanted to revisit this post to be fair with this excellent card, below is my review rewritten to account for most recent experiences.-----------------------------------------------------This card is great, excellent graphics very acceptable sound levels, a plus is that it already comes a bit overclocked but from my experience there is room for even more.The performance is awesome and running it with a Corei7 920 OCd to 3.2. On a HD monitor I am able to max out on graphics and the card load does not go to the top (usually peaks around 70%). Beware this will be different with newer games and higher res monitors.OLDER ISSUE ---> Fan speed fixed at 44%, my card runs hotter than it should, the "auto" fan speed does not work and fans remain at 44% until the card gets too hot and the whole system shuts down.--- REVIEWED ---> With the newest Nvidia Drivers fans worked fine and card temps are quite manageable.OLDER ISSUE ---> I thought I might be having issues with the hot air exhausting into the case, that is a minus for me and probably would have chosen a different model that takes the hot air out of the case. Afterwards I improved air circulation, but still if forget to set the fans manually to 100% speed before playing graphic demanding games the card eventually shuts down the PC.--- REVIEWED ---> This card requires a full tower case with plenty of fans, I just did not have enough air movement with my older case. I upgraded to a NZXT Phantom, 4x140 + 2x200 fans, enough to move all the hot air out of the componentes chamber and to keep the GPU temps in check. Running stress tests I've got peak temps of 75° celsius and fans around 60% (remember the newest driver is also lendign a hand here.OLDER ISSUE ---> Then I wrote in ZOTAC's forum regarding the fixed fan speeds, but no one has answered in a week yet.--- REVIEWED ---> I had some answers but at the time I already realized the main problem was my case, so I did not implement the card until it arrived and when installed the old problems disspeared. To be fair, the answers I was given I am sure will get me rid of the problems and made me able to use my older case, but I did not mind anymore.Final thoughts: excellent card, but at the tag price you will be better off buying a GTX 580. I'd go with Zotac easily for that one too, or if you want that much muscle, the 590 is already announced...

5King of the Hill
By Dan E.
The Zotac Amp GTX 480 is one amazing card. First, the temps are insanely cooler compared to the temps on a stock GTX 480. While running Furmark, I reached only 68c degrees using xtreme burn-in mode. The funny part is that the fan speeds were only running at 44%. As a result of the lower fan speeds, the card remained very quiet. I could not perceive the noise difference between idle and load. When I'm just gaming the temps reach 55-60c degrees. In idle mode the card sits at 34 degrees. This is a very cool running card, and by far the quietest card I ever owned. Just make sure you have good air flow in your case, because this card exhausts all the heat into the case. If you are in the market for a GTX 480, I would recommend the Zotac Amp edition. You get a slightly overclocked card and a way better cooling solution.
